  3. TS Photoline APO refractor wit 72 mm aperture and fast f/6 focal ratio, a great travel telescope for observation and astrophotography.


    • ♦ Powerful, aberration-free apochromatic refractor with 72 mm aperture and 432 mm focal length.
    • ♦ Fast focal ratio: f/6
    • ♦ FPL53 doublet objective (Ohara Japan), air-spaced - additional lanthanum element, so no chromatic aberration
    • ♦ 2.5" dual-speed rack-and-pinion focuser - ball bearing mounted for maximum load with M63x1 female thread for adaptions
    • ♦ Retractable dew cap - the apo even fits into the hand luggage
    • ♦ CNC tube rings with versatile dovetail bar - EQ5 style and with photo tripod connection.
    • ♦ Findershoe on the focuser is included
    • ♦ Weight only 2.18 kg - transport length only 31 cm

  12. The powerful 6-element Apo with 76 mm aperture and 342 mm focal length has been developed by Teleskop-Service for astrophotography.

    • Aperture 76 mm
    • Focal length 342 mm
    • High focal ratio f/4.5 for short exposure times
    • Illuminated and corrected image field of 44 mm diameter - usable up to full format
    • Multi-coated FPL53 APO Triplet lens, free from false color
    • Screwed 3-element ED corrector with 55 mm working distance from the M48 camera connection
    • 3" RAP rack and pinion focuser with 360° rotation possibility
    • 2" and 1.25" connection for observation are included - 1.25" and 2" accessories can be used
    • 2" nebula filters can be screwed into the corrector
    • CNC tube rings with handle, viewfinder shoe and V-style dovetail bar are included in delivery
    • The handle offers adaptation options for guide scope or camera
